How does Ibogaine, an indole alkaloid with hallucinogenic properties, emerge as an instrumental treatment for drug addiction, particularly opiates? 

The answer lies in the sophisticated interplay of chemicals within our brain and the unique role of NMDA receptors.

The underlying principle is simple yet profound: opiates interact with specific receptors in our brain. 

In the absence of these drugs, the receptors lie vacant, triggering cravings that many individuals in recovery experience.

However, scientific studies show that Ibogaine has the unique ability to bind to these same receptors, notably the N-methyl-D-aspartate (NMDA) receptors. 

Research from Chen et al., (1996) demonstrates that Ibogaine is an open-channel NMDA receptor antagonist, leading to a slow, concentration-dependent block of NMDA-induced currents. 

This interaction plays a crucial role in addiction treatment.

A single administration of Ibogaine, potentially followed by a few smaller doses for more severe addictions, can significantly reduce the notorious “cold turkey” withdrawal symptoms by 80-90% on average. Importantly, Ibogaine is not addictive. 

Once ingested, it is metabolized by the liver into noribogaine, its active metabolite, which lingers in the body for weeks or months following a single dose. 

Noribogaine assists in curbing post-treatment withdrawal symptoms and may also function as an anti-depressant.

The Role of Neuroplasticity and NMDA Antagonism

Ibogaine’s interaction with NMDA receptors and its subsequent impact on neuroplasticity, the brain’s ability to reorganize itself by forming new neural connections, is crucial to its therapeutic benefits. 

Popik et al., (1995) discovered that pharmacologically relevant concentrations of Ibogaine produce a voltage-dependent block of NMDA receptors. 

This interaction is instrumental in attenuating addiction-related phenomena and contributes to Ibogaine’s reputed anti-addictive properties.
